Mehal - Dharamkot, Moga
Mehal is a village situated in the Dharamkot tehsil of Moga district, Punjab. It is located approximately 18 km from Moga and around 18 km from Moga. Mahal serves as the Gram Panchayat for Mehal village.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Mehal is 034088. The village covers a total geographical area of 485 hectares and falls under the 142043 pincode. Dharamkot is the nearest town.
Mehal village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Dharamkot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Faridkot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.
Population of Mehal
As per Census 2011, Mehal village has a total population of 1,314 people, consisting of 678 males and 636 females. The village has 263 households and a sex ratio of 938 females per 1,000 males. There are 150 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 844 literate and 470 illiterate residents. Additionally, 585 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ities.
Detailed gender-wise population figures for Mehal are given below:
| Category |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Population | 1,314 | 678 | 636 |
|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 150 | 78 | 72 |
| Scheduled Castes (SC) | 585 | 305 | 280 |
| Literate Population | 844 | 476 | 368 |
| Illiterate Population | 470 | 202 | 268 |

Transport and Connectivity of Mehal
Mehal is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ws. The nearest railway station is Dagru, while the nearest airport is Ludhiana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 70.3 km.
